Practice 2 gave us some changes but Williams and Brawn GP remained consistent at the top.
The top three consisted of Rosberg followed by Barrichello and Trulli. Three different teams using the much talked about diffusers. I personally think it could be well over a second boost in the new diffusers and I hope it will remain legal since the other teams could catch up a few races later.

Mclaren looked very poor and so did Ferrari, however don't take note of Ferrari as it looked like they were doing endurance testing. We heard Hamilton complaining alot of times about the downforce and grip in the car calling it "worthless". Red Bull are looking pretty strong with 4th (Webber) and 8th (Vettel). They seem to have gotten back some of the lacking grip they needed. Vettel ran off again in testing and this time lost the last 30 minutes of testing due to running into the grass before corner 4. (which he did repeatedly)

Here's a list of the Surprises at the end of the day.

Good

Diffusers power. The diffusers seem to help Brawn GP, Toyota and Williams alot and I think it won't be many racers until the other teams will try to adapt and improve their car the same.

Force India. Force India seems alot more aggressive and willing to try different things. Their partnership with Mclaren seems to be paying off.

Even field. The field at this practice was very even with alot of new cars at the top which is positive to see.

Bad

Renault. Renault doesn't seem to be able to cut it today ending up pretty much at the bottom of both testings not counting STR, however Toro Rosso isn't a big money team and there always has to be a team on the bottom.

Mclaren. Mclaren has also not adapted very well and to quote Hamilton himself the car is "worthless". They need to do something fast if they want to be in contention for the title at the end of the year.

Sebastian Vettel. Doing the same mistake of driving out the grass BEFORE a corner three times in a row is a GP2 mistake. A huge driver error made by him and even the commentators were shocked by him continually doing the same mistake which eventually made him miss the last 30 minutes of the second practice as well.
